Good video, but many modern latches have basic anti-shimming measures that would stop this and other shims. On your home door knobs, see how there is a 2 part latch? The 2nd part will stay engaged even if shimmed.
This video is showing examples, massively common, where those things are installed improperly so that this 2nd part doesn't engage in all conditions (or ever). If you look closely, you'll see these are mostly exactly that kind of latch.
